Monitoring student engagement via analytics: the problem with Moodle folders

Files, such as Word documents, can easily be added to Moodle as File resources. Some teachers prefer to upload a number of files into a folder instead of keeping them separate. However, there are generally more advantages to adding the files individually. You can do very much more with individual files that is not possible …

How students can change account settings in ExamSys

ExamSys is the University’s e-assessment system used for online assessment, including formal summative exams, taken under exam conditions, and informal formative self-assessment quizzes. ExamSys is used for some but not all modules. If you are a student your ExamSys account is set up with your usual University username and password. Each year, you will automatically …
